Commercial Slab Installation in Grand Junction, CO

Commercial slab installation services involve the construction of solid concrete foundations for various types of business and industrial projects. This service is commonly used for creating the base for warehouses, retail stores, office buildings, parking lots, and other large-scale structures. Property owners typically want to understand the scope of the project, including site preparation, the quality of materials used, and how the slab will support the intended use. Proper installation ensures stability, durability, and long-term performance of the structure, making it a crucial step in commercial development.

Before requesting commercial slab installation, property owners should consider factors such as the size and layout of the area, soil conditions, and any specific load requirements for the structure. It’s also important to understand the necessary permits and regulations in the area. Clear communication about project expectations, timeline, and site conditions can help ensure the installation process proceeds smoothly and results in a foundation that meets the needs of the property.

Common Commercial Slab Installation Jobs

Commercial slab installation involves preparing and pouring concrete slabs for new commercial buildings or expansions.

Foundation slabs provide a stable base for warehouses, retail spaces, and office structures.

Sidewalk and loading dock slabs improve accessibility and functionality for commercial properties.

Parking lot slabs create durable surfaces for vehicle storage and customer access.

Concrete slab repairs address cracks, settling, or damage to maintain safety and longevity.

Slab replacement services involve removing and replacing old or damaged concrete foundations.

Commercial Slab Installation Questions

What types of projects require a concrete slab? Concrete slabs are commonly used for driveways, patios, garage floors, and commercial building foundations in Grand Junction and nearby areas.

How thick should a commercial slab be? The thickness depends on the intended use, but typical commercial slabs range from 4 to 6 inches thick to support heavy loads.

What factors influence the durability of a concrete slab? Proper site preparation, quality materials, and correct installation techniques contribute to a durable and long-lasting slab.

Is a permit needed for installing a concrete slab? Permit requirements vary by location; it’s advisable to check with local building authorities before beginning the project.
